>> FUNDRAISING, GRANTS, & PARTNERSHIPS
>>
>> During April, the Wikimedia Foundation received 922 donations, with a
>> combined total value of USD 78,453.   Year-to-date, the Wikimedia
>> Foundation has raised USD 5,491415 in donations from individuals, 37%
>> above the full-year target of USD 4,000,000.

> As always, thanks for these reports. I'm curious - 37% is a lot of
> extra money, is there a plan for how to spend it? Has this year's
> spending been increased or will the extra just be carried over to next
> year or just kept as reserves?

As always, you are hugely welcome -- it's my pleasure :-)

I will ask Veronique to reply a little more fully, but here's the gist:

1) That paragraph of the report doesn't cover our full financial
picture -- total revenues weren't up 37%, just individual donations as
a subset of total revenues. So, there was not a USD 1.49 million
"surplus" -- it was less than that, because other areas
under-performed against plan in the same period.  Also bear in mind
that spending varied relative to plan, as well.

2) #1 notwithstanding, we are indeed thinking about what to do with
money unspent in a given year. In general, I do not want the Wikimedia
Foundation to accumulate massive reserves -- generally, because donors
give money in hopes it will be spent usefully. But at the same time,
it would be imprudent to have no financial cushion at all. This is one
of the issues Veronique and I think about quite a bit, and I know she
is hoping that the strategy project will work on it too. How much
reserve is enough, when is it time to build towards an endowment.
